There are 700 colleges in the U.S. where you can study and earn a degree in criminal justice/safety studies. These are the top ranked colleges offering majors in criminal justice/safety studies based on the CollegeSimply ranking methodology. The average net price to attend these colleges is $13,247 per year. Blue Ridge Community and Technical College offers the cheapest criminal justice/safety studies degree with an average net price of $4,070 annually.
